<img src="http://www.joplinglobeonline.com/images/zope/policeandfire.gif" border=0 > Robbery charges filed against two men from Carthage

CARTHAGE, Mo. — Robbery charges have been filed against two men accused of swiping a tip jar at a Carthage bar.

Casey Aaron Gouge, 28, and Scott Brandon Browning, 26, both of Carthage, were arrested last week after a Carthage police investigation of a strong-arm robbery the night of Jan. 5 at Jim’s Bar.

Sgt. David Strubberg said two men walked out of the bar with a tip jar containing $15, and a bartender tried to stop them. When one of the men struck the bartender, a man came to her aid and was assaulted as well, Strubberg said. The robbers then fled on foot.

Strubberg said warrants were obtained for the arrest of Gouge and Browning on charges of second-degree robbery, and both men were taken into custody. Gouge posted $5,000 bond and was released. Browning remained in custody Monday at the Jasper County Jail, with his bond also set at $5,000.
